Dog grooming solutions by layer type and lifestyle

Short-coated types like Beagles, Martial Artists, and Staffordshire blends do not get clipper cuts, however take advantage of routine bathrooms, layer de-shedding rubs with rubber curry brushes, and thorough drying that raises dead hair. With these dogs, it is simple to underestimate shedding volume. In my experience, a 25 minute burn out every 4 to 6 weeks can cut tumbleweeds at home by half.

Double-coated breeds, usual in our location, from Huskies to German Shepherds, impact coat seasonally and also on a loosened 3 to 4 month cycle. A healthy de-shed bath uses a coat-specific hair shampoo, a conditioner to launch undercoat, and a series of high rate drying and line cleaning. Avoid cutting these breeds to the skin. It can harm coat texture, increase sunburn risk, and affect just breed-specific haircut how the layer insulates. A neat with feather neatening and sanitary job maintains them comfortable without endangering layer function.

Poodle and doodle coats need rhythm. If you like a cosy teddy trim, your buddy is frequency. Every 4 to 6 weeks with at-home cleaning every other day keeps the coat from felting at the underarms, behind the ears, and in the groin. If you intend to stretch to 8 to 10 weeks, speak with your groomer about a shorter, functional size that can hold up. A 1 inch plush appearance lasts if the layer is constantly detangled, but matted coats require a reset to a short clip for the canine's convenience and safety.

Terriers and cable layers gain from either clippering or hand stripping. True hand removing preserves shade and appearance, but it requires time and ability. In Fayetteville, some groomers offer a hybrid approach, hand removing the back and furnishings while clippering delicate areas. If a type common matters to you, ask particularly about removing experience and routine longer appointments.

Seniors or pet dogs with health and wellness problems need adjustments. Reduced heat drying out, short breaks off the table, non-slip mats, gentle dematting tools, and occasionally a two-visit plan decrease fatigue. I have divided a groom for a 14 year old Shih Tzu right into bath and nails on day one, haircut on day two, at the owner's request. An excellent beauty parlor will fit within reason.

Cat grooming services tailored to stress

Cats reviewed the area. A salon that takes care of pet cats on set days or during peaceful hours minimizes stress and anxiety. Ask whether they work with a feline-only block or different felines from canines in a various room. For services, many pet cats succeed with a bath and thorough comb-out every 8 to 12 weeks if they are long-haired. Maine Coons and Persians matt along the spinal column, behind the forelegs, and near the tail base. Mats are not aesthetic. They pull skin, conceal particles, and can trap wetness that results in sores.

Lion cuts have their function when a layer is pelted or the pet cat is older and can not brush correctly. The trick is risk-free handling. A positive cat groomer clips with guarded blades, keeps sessions effective, and watches for warm stress and anxiety. Many will certainly not supply anal gland expression for felines, which is reasonable, and will certainly prevent tweezing ear hair unless a veterinarian suggests it. For fractious felines, some beauty salons will refer to a vet clinic that can sedate safely. That is not a failure. It is liable threat management.

What "safety initial" appears like behind the scenes

You can not view the whole bridegroom, but you can recognize signs of a well-run shop. Tables and bathtubs need to be strong with working restrictions that safeguard an animal without choking. Clothes dryer hose pipes must be tidy, filters transformed typically, and warmth setups conservative. Cage clothes dryers are questionable for a factor. They can be risk-free when made use of on ambient or low heat with direct guidance and timers, however they need to never alternative to hands-on drying in brachycephalic types like Bulldogs or Pugs.

Good beauty salons likewise log cases. If a clipper shed occurs on a poodle foot due to the fact that an animal kicked at the incorrect moment, it gets documented, proprietors are educated at pickup, after-care is explained, and the next appointment readjusts method. Mishaps are rare in cautious hands, however absolutely no openness is a red flag.

Managing nervous pets and first-timers

Anxiety appears as trembling, yawning, lip licking, or outright rejection to tip through the door. For dogs brand-new to grooming or rescues with irregular background, choreograph the very first check out. Walk when around the building, allow the pet dog smell, and maintain your energy calm. Inside, a short meet-and-greet adhered to by a nail trim or a bathroom just is kinder than a marathon. Some beauty parlors enable you to bring a preferred mat or tee shirt that scents like home for the kennel. Avoid square meals right before the visit to prevent nausea in the bathtub. If your pet dog rises under the clothes dryer, a good groomer will change to a towel and lower airflow, or schedule a two-part drying out session.

Desensitization in the house pays off. Mimic clipper noise with an electrical tooth brush near the pet dog, deal with paws for seconds each day, and incentive. I have actually turned errors right into stoics over 3 check outs by coupling short, easy wins with individual handling. It is not magic. It is repetition.

Maintenance between consultations that saves money

Brushing is less costly than dematting. Utilize a slicker brush and a stainless steel comb. The brush lifts hair, the comb discovers tangles the brush skates over. Concentrate on friction zones: behind ears, underarms, collar line, tail base, and where legs fulfill the body. For double-coated breeds, an once a week 10 minute undercoat rake session followed by a fast brush decreases dropping and maintains skin healthy. Keep nails trimmed every 3 to 4 weeks. Lengthy nails change gait, stress joints, and make grooming more stressful since quicks grow with the nail.

Bathing in your home is fine if you rinse thoroughly. Leftover hair shampoo creates itch. Dry entirely to the skin, specifically on undercoated breeds and longhairs. Moist undercoat can mold, and moist mats tighten up as they dry. If you do not have a high velocity dryer, blot with towels, brush while drying on a low, great setting, and strategy additional time.

Seasonal realities in the Sandhills

Spring and loss bring coat blows. Expect larger losing and longer de-shed sessions. Summertime heat argues for shorter trims on decrease layers like Shih Tzus and Yorkies, however cut to the skin is hardly ever the solution beyond severe matting. For double coats, keep the natural defense and concentrate on airflow with a great brush out. Ticks and fleas increase in cozy months, so keep preventives existing and inform your groomer if you have seen bugs. The majority of beauty salons call for treatment before a groom if real-time fleas exist, or they will add a flea bath and quarantine to maintain the beauty parlor clean.

Winter dry skin can create dandruff. A gentle oatmeal or hypoallergenic shampoo coupled with a conditioner helps. If a pet dog is itchy post-groom, ask the beauty salon what products were used and take into consideration patch screening a sensitive-skin formula following time.

How often should you groom a dog?

The frequency of grooming depends on breed, coat type, and lifestyle. Short-haired dogs may only need grooming every 6–8 weeks, while long-haired or high-maintenance breeds often require grooming every 4–6 weeks. Regular brushing between sessions helps prevent matting. Professional grooming ensures coat health, cleanliness, and nail care.
